Impact Update: Checking in with A Child’s Place
Apparo connected A Child’s Place with AAA Carolinas to help them select a case management application for tracking and reporting on the homeless children they serve.
TechShop: Lily Pad Haven
Lily Pad Haven received training on the use of SharePoint and OneDrive. Kevin Yount from CapTech conducted the training. By working with Apparo, they received this training at a fee of approximately 75% below market value.
Community Impact Project: Arts and Science Council: Technology Assessment + Plan
Apparo matched the Arts & Science Council with a corporate volunteer team from Hylaine to asses their technology landscape and make recommendations for improvement.
